Output ed3c260801b373b275d14b5196c91cffa501f3064b5069a0b0e7b2c22db3b8f1:1

value
329636180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d8956f347a1634198b55131fa6f1da7ba45f38 OP_EQUAL
address
34QpycDqru3bxfG4J9CgtBZDujSqUg83JU
transaction
ed3c260801b373b275d14b5196c91cffa501f3064b5069a0b0e7b2c22db3b8f1
spent
true